Output 2e165de801c13e78411479c414f841bea624540c585742f54e33da5b0b4493aa:2

value
421074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ae2a614715700c3d34d6a45e9a66c37acd84c325 OP_EQUAL
address
3HZvGY28ubeLJWA9VCzgXUnF8S7Cz5VShk
transaction
2e165de801c13e78411479c414f841bea624540c585742f54e33da5b0b4493aa
confirmations
285279
spent
true